APPROVED: � �/�, /� RECORDER December 11 , 1939 • • At a regular meeting of the Mayor and Town Council of the Town of Leesburg , - in Virginia held in the Council Chamber on Mobday, December 11 , 1939 at 7 :30 P. I.I. , there were present , Lucas D. Phillips , Mayor ; Louis T. Titus , Recorder and J. L. Oliver, L.C.Rollins , J.D. Taylor and - J . H. Turley , Councilmen; T • he minutes of the last regular meeting held on November , 13th 1939 and the minutes of a special meeting held on December 4th 1939 were :read and upon motion duly made •seconded and •carried , were qpproved as read. • • On motion of Councilman Oliver , seconded by Councilman Rollins and unanimously carried the following Resolution was 'adopted ; BE IT RESOLVED, by the Council of the Town of'Leesburg , in Virginia that ,'tRodsoe B. Rhoads , •Auditor-Treasurer , be. and he is hereby authorized to have erected one street light near the corporate limits on East Market Street for which the town will pay the Virginia Public Service Company the usual rate. The Auditor-Treasurer read his monthly statement for the month of November. On motion of Councilman Rollins , seconded by Councilman Turley and unanimously carried the following Resolution was adopted ; BE IT RESOLVED, by the Council of the Town of Leesburg, in Virginia , that the Building Committee be and it is hereby authorized , instructed and directed to have the contractor , T. E. Fisher who is building a garage for the town on the pumping station lot , install tounged and grooved roofers in place of ,the rough. roofers specified in the specifications of the building. • B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, by the Council •of the Town of Leesburg , in Virginia that the, Auditor-Treasurer be and he is thereby authorized , instructed and directed to pay the difference in the price of the tounged and grooved roofers and the rough roofers for use .on the garage building now under construction on the pumping station lot. On motion of Councilman Rollins , seconded by Councilman Turley and unanimously carried the following Resolution Was adopted ; WHEREAS, Roscoe B. Rhoads , Auditor-Treasurer ,. reports that thera is the sum of $1 , 731.46in the sinking Fund ; and WHEREAS, there are $10 ,000.00 water bonds out-standing callable and payable at any time : PLOW, THEREFORE,' BE IT RESOLVED , by the, Council of the Town of Leesburg , in Virginia , that the Auditor-Treasurer be and he is hereby authorized , instructed and directed to call and pay one of the said $1,000.00 bonds , together with accrued interest therepn on or before the 15th day of December ,1939. • On motion of Councilman Turley , seconded by Councilman Taylor and unanimously carried , the following Resolution was adopted ; BE IT RESOLVED, by the Council of the Town of Leesburg , in Virginia that the Street 9ommittee for streets South of Market • Streets be and it is hereby authorized , instructed and directed to have the damage to the property of Charles F. Harrison near the Corner of. Market and Church Streets , caused- by the sewer construction repaired. -There being no further business , on botion duly made , seconded and carried the Council adjourned at 8 :57 F. M.
